Let’s take a closer look at the ingredients that make up this heavenly dip. The star of the show is, of course, the cheese. You can use a combination of cheddar, colby, or Monterey Jack for a classic flavor. If you’re feeling adventurous, try adding a bit of bleu cheese or gouda for a more robust taste. To create the creamy texture, you’ll need sour cream and cream cheese, which will blend seamlessly with the cheese to create a smooth and luxurious dip. Spices like garlic powder, onion powder, and paprika can be added for a little kick, while a dash of salt and pepper will bring out the flavors of the other ingredients.
Now that you know the basics of Cheese Crockpot Dip, it’s time to get cooking! Here’s a simple recipe to get you started:
Ingredients:
- 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
- 1 cup shredded colby cheese
- 1 cup shredded Monterey Jack cheese
- 1/2 cup cream cheese, softened
- 1 cup sour cream
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- 1/2 teaspoon paprika
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on pepper
Instructions:
- Combine the shredded cheeses in a large mixing bowl.
- Add the softened cream cheese and sour cream to the cheese mixture, stirring until well combined.
- Stir in the gar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, salt, and pepper.
- Transfer the mixture to a crockpot and cook on low for 2-3 hours, or until the dip is bubbly and hot.
- Serve with your choice of dippers and enjoy!
